How does Instant Secure Erase work?

By instantly returning the drive to its factory settings and altering the encryption key, Seagate Instant Secure Erase is made to protect the data on hard disk drives by ensuring that any data still present on the drive is cryptographically erased. What task would require a metatarsal guard?

What tasks might require the use of a metatarsal guard? The law states that when there is a “substantial risk of a crushing injury” to the foot, metatarsal protection should be offered. Are govt securities tax free?

State and local taxes are typically not levied on the interest income from bonds issued by the federal government and its agencies, including Treasury securities. What securities are tax free?
